Output e12f63dd85c8a6446d42b09fcddceed32ae3abc91d894a82eb6131d6b76019ed:3

value
42146
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 16f3c71086ac5d157e1a927978cc1e3046e1163e832add6f7add09cc1cee039c
address
bc1pzmeuwyyx43w32ls6jfuh3nq7xprwz937sv4d6mm6m5yuc88wqwwqhqqdrw
transaction
e12f63dd85c8a6446d42b09fcddceed32ae3abc91d894a82eb6131d6b76019ed
spent
true